/**
 * An interface to read from the database within Convex query functions.
 *
 * The two entry points are {@link DatabaseReader.get}, which fetches a single
 * document by its {@link values.GenericId}, or {@link DatabaseReader.query}, which starts
 * building a query.
 *
 * If you're using code generation, use the `DatabaseReader` type in
 * `convex/_generated/server.d.ts` which is typed for your data model.
 *
 * @public
 */
export interface DatabaseReader<DataModel extends GenericDataModel> {
    /**
     * Fetch a single document from the database by its {@link values.GenericId}.
     *
     * @param id - The {@link values.GenericId} of the document to fetch from the database.
     * @returns - The {@link GenericDocument} of the document at the given {@link values.GenericId}, or `null` if it no longer exists.
     */
    get<TableName extends TableNamesInDataModel<DataModel>>(id: GenericId<TableName>): Promise<DocumentByName<DataModel, TableName> | null>;
    /**
     * Begin a query for the given table name.
     *
     * Queries don't execute immediately, so calling this method and extending its
     * query are free until the results are actually used.
     *
     * @param tableName - The name of the table to query.
     * @returns - A {@link QueryInitializer} object to start building a query.
     */
    query<TableName extends TableNamesInDataModel<DataModel>>(tableName: TableName): QueryInitializer<NamedTableInfo<DataModel, TableName>>;
}
/**
 * An interface to read from and write to the database within Convex mutation
 * functions.
 *
 * Convex guarantees that all writes within a single mutation are
 * executed atomically, so you never have to worry about partial writes leaving
 * your data in an inconsistent state. See [the Convex Guide](https://docs.convex.dev/understanding/convex-fundamentals/functions#atomicity-and-optimistic-concurrency-control)
 * for the guarantees Convex provides your functions.
 *
 *  If you're using code generation, use the `DatabaseReader` type in
 * `convex/_generated/server.d.ts` which is typed for your data model.
 *
 * @public
 */
export interface DatabaseWriter<DataModel extends GenericDataModel> extends DatabaseReader<DataModel> {
    /**
     * Insert a new document into a table.
     *
     * @param table - The name of the table to insert a new document into.
     * @param value - The {@link values.Value} to insert into the given table.
     * @returns - {@link values.GenericId} of the new document.
     */
    insert<TableName extends TableNamesInDataModel<DataModel>>(table: TableName, value: WithoutSystemFields<DocumentByName<DataModel, TableName>>): Promise<GenericId<TableName>>;
    /**
     * Patch an existing document, merging its value with a new values.
     *
     * Any overlapping fields in the two documents will be overwritten with
     * their new value.
     *
     * @param id - The {@link values.GenericId} of the document to patch.
     * @param value - The partial {@link GenericDocument} to merge into the specified document. If this new value
     * specifies system fields like `_id`, they must match the document's existing field values.
     */
    patch<TableName extends TableNamesInDataModel<DataModel>>(id: GenericId<TableName>, value: Partial<DocumentByName<DataModel, TableName>>): Promise<void>;
    /**
     * Replace the value of an existing document, overwriting its old value.
     *
     * @param id - The {@link values.GenericId} of the document to replace.
     * @param value - The new {@link GenericDocument} for the document. This value can omit the system fields,
     * and the database will fill them in.
     */
    replace<TableName extends TableNamesInDataModel<DataModel>>(id: GenericId<TableName>, value: WithOptionalSystemFields<DocumentByName<DataModel, TableName>>): Promise<void>;
    /**
     * Delete an existing document.
     *
     * @param id - The {@link values.GenericId} of the document to remove.
     */
    delete(id: GenericId<TableNamesInDataModel<DataModel>>): Promise<void>;
}
